Sonny is a resident at a hospital in NYC's Little India when he's assigned a new patient, one with so many foreign organs that he's just called the Transplanted Man. Sonny also starts a relationship with a nurse, Gwen, who has a condition due to which her appetites periodically rage out of control. Add in an aging film star, a relucatant guru, a restaurant owner, medical researchers working on sleep disorrders (Sonny sleep walks), a hypokinetic man who takes minutes to move a step and it's a rich tapestry of Indian American life. East meets West in this romp of a novel that combines the hilarity of Catch-22 with the urgency of ER and the poignancy of The World According to Garp. Sonny Seth is a brilliant but rebellious medical resident at a New York hospital that services a community of eccentric expatriates from India. His most demanding patient and trusted confidant known only as the Transplanted Man is a high-level Indian government official whose major organs have been transplanted at least once. Deathly ill but amusingly wise, he is now hunted by assassins and his sneaky nemesis, a Bollywood superstar vying for stardom in politics. Trying to solve his patient s ballooning afflictions, Sonny faces demons of his own in a soul-searching journey that will involve a bibliophilic English nurse, a scientist desperate to discover a cure for insomnia, and a psychotherapist constantly confused for a New Age guru. With a cast of wonderfully drawn characters, Transplanted Man offers a new kind of passage to India, and pays tribute to the rich, bristling subculture where India and America intersect.
